Abstract

In order to have a reliable and robust data transmission in digital communication system, channel coding is applied for improving the performance of the system. Convolutional code is one of channel coding technique for error detection and error correction. In this paper, convolutional code is used for improving the bit error rate (BER) performance in Quadrature Phase Shift Keying (QPSK)modulation scheme which is implemented on a Wireless Open-Access Research Platform (WARP). Based on implementation and measurement results show that with an equal transmit power (with Tx gain =20dB), QPSK modulation with convolutional code have a lower BER than the uncoded one. For convolutional code with rate =1/2 at a range of 6 meter has a BER value of 0.00065232 while the uncoded BER is 0.0048828. By comparison of the system performance with different coding rate (1/2,2/3,3/4.5/6 and 7/8), the BER performance of QPSK system with convolutional code rate of 7/8 is better that the others. It can achieve a BER of 0.00037495.
